
3.5 Analog Input Connections
The ADS1x48EVM is designed for easy interface to external temperature sensors using the two screw terminal
blocks (J5 and J6). Connector J5 provides connections for thermocouples and thermistors as well as the 2.048-V
output voltage from the ADS1x48 integrated reference and the dedicated 2.5-V output from the REF5025.
Connector J6 includes a pair of differential reference inputs for connecting an external voltage reference source
to the ADC as well as three dedicated terminals for connecting a 2-, 3-, or 4-wire RTD.

Table 3-3. ADS1x48EVM Terminal Block Input Description (J5 and J6)
Terminal Block Input
Label
Description
J5:1
TC+
Positive thermocouple, general-purpose input
J5:2
TC–
Negative thermocouple, general-purpose input
J5:3
REF5025
2.5-V output from REF5025
J5:4
REFOUT
2.048-V output from ADS1x48 integrated VREF
J5:5
NTC+
Positive thermistor input
J5:6
NTC–
Negative thermistor input
J6:1
REFP1
Positive external VREF input to ADC
J6:2
REFN1
Negative external VREF input to ADC
J6:3
RTD_A
RTD connection point A
J6:4
RTD_B
RTD connection point B
J6:5
RTD_C
RTD connection point C
J6:6
GND
Analog ground
